The Position

As a Junior KYC Analyst, you will join the Risk Department of VAROPreem in Rotterdam in an entry-level role designed for someone at the start of their career who is eager to learn, take on responsibility, and grow into a trusted risk and compliance professional.

“Know Your Customer” (KYC) is a core principle within our organisation, focused on conducting thorough due diligence to ensure that both new and existing business partners meet the high standards we set. In this role, you will work closely with an experienced KYC Specialist and become part of a broader Risk team covering KYC, Credit Risk, and Market Risk.

From the outset, you will be involved in real assessments that directly support commercial decision-making while protecting the organisation. The Risk Department plays a central role in the business, with the ambition to act not only as a control function but also as a value-adding partner, and as a Junior KYC Analyst, you will contribute directly to that objective.
This role goes beyond administrative tasks as you will gain insight into why decisions are made and how risk-based thinking supports business success.

               

Your Key Responsibilities

  • Conducting KYC assessments for new and existing counterparties;

  • Maintaining and improving the KYC database, ensuring accuracy and completeness;

  • Monitoring customer information and identifying potential integrity and compliance risks;

  • Analysing ownership structures, business activities, and risk profiles;

  • Supporting clear and structured reporting for internal decision-making;

  • Contributing to process improvements to enhance efficiency and effectiveness;

  • Communicating with internal stakeholders and learning to explain risk-based decisions clearly.
